CPR for Family and Friends

Last Thursday, we took our final class at the hospital. This time we learned how to perform CPR and the Heimlich Maneuver on infants, children, and adults. We watched a video made by the American Heart Association that explained all the techniques used to revive someone that has had a heart attack, cardiac arrest, stroke, or is choking. While watching the video, we used life-like manikins to practice our rescue breathing and chest compressions until we were proficient. Although it wasn't a certification course, we will hopefully know how to act and what to do if we are ever placed into a situation where we need to revive someone.
